As I said to imperium in the post below, once you've got your PAL, it's a good idea to start out with a .22 rifle. They're cheap to buy, allow you to hone your skills without worrying about recoil, and are cheap to feed: 500 rounds of .22 are about $20.00 tax included. Later on, you can get your RPAL and get into handguns, again starting with a .22.
